7 Easy Steps To Control Pests And Diseases In Agriculture

There are several steps you can take to control pests and diseases in your garden or farm:

  1. Choose resistant plants: Select plants that are naturally resistant to common pests and diseases in your area. This will reduce the need for chemical controls.

  2. Maintain good garden hygiene: Regularly removing dead plant material, weeds, and any infected plants can help reduce the spread of pests and diseases.

  3. Crop rotation: Rotating crops each year can help to break the life cycle of pests and reduce the build-up of soil-borne diseases.

  4. Provide proper care: Maintaining healthy plants by providing adequate water, light, and nutrients can help to make them more resistant to pests and diseases.

  5. Use physical controls: Barriers such as row covers, screens, and sticky traps can help to physically exclude pests from your garden.

  6. Use biological controls: Beneficial insects such as ladybugs, lacewings, and predatory mites can help to control pests in your garden.

  7. Use selective pesticides: If necessary, use pesticides that target specific pests, and avoid broad-spectrum pesticides that can harm beneficial insects and the environment.
